If youâve ever dreamed of seeing the world but felt tied down by work, family, or the daily grind, your 60s and beyond might just be the golden ticket. Retirement or semi-retirement opens up a whole new chapter – one where your time is your own, and the world is waiting.
Letâs face it, life gets busy. But now, with fewer responsibilities and more freedom, you can finally take that trip youâve been talking about for years. Whether youâre planning a retirement travel adventure or just a weekend escape, this is your time to explore. With grown-up kids, a paid-off mortgage, and a bit more financial breathing room, travel becomes less of a dream and more of a plan.
After decades of building careers and raising families, itâs normal to wonder whatâs next. Travel gives you a fresh sense of purpose. Especially if youâre trying solo travel over 60, youâll find yourself making decisions, solving problems, and navigating new places. Itâs empowering – and a great reminder that youâre still growing. Solo travel for seniors is a growing trend, so youâre quite likely to meet others on the same path too.
Stepping out of your comfort zone is one of the best ways to reconnect with yourself. Booking flights, figuring out local transport, and trying new foods all build confidence. You might discover a love for photography, a knack for languages, or simply enjoy the thrill of mastering something new. Travel isnât just about seeing new places – itâs about seeing yourself in a new light.
Whether youâre wandering through a quiet village in Spain or navigating the buzz of a city like Bangkok, every destination offers a new perspective. Cultural travel when one has had more life experience is especially rewarding – youâll gain insight and appreciation of different ways of life, traditions, and values. Itâs a reminder that the world is vast, diverse, and endlessly fascinating.
One of the joys of travel is the people you meet along the way. From friendly locals to fellow travellers, the connections you make can be surprisingly deep. Homestay travel is a brilliant option for older travellers – enabling you to stay in the homes of friendly locals and truly experience the local culture. These relationships often turn into lasting friendships. Retirement doesnât mean slowing down; itâs a chance to dive into new interests. Travel keeps your mind active and your curiosity alive. Whether youâre learning to cook Thai food, picking up a few phrases in Italian, or trying something adventurous like kayaking or hiking, every trip is a chance to grow.
The best part of travelling later in life? You get to do it on your own terms. Want to hike the Scottish Highlands? Go for it. Prefer to sip wine in a quiet French village? Thatâs perfect too. Thereâs no right or wrong way to explore, just whatever feels good to you. And with modern tech, staying in touch with loved ones is easier than ever.
Whether itâs a short escape or a months-long journey, the world is wide, welcoming, and ready for you. So if youâve been waiting for the âright time,â this might just be it.
